Assistant Chef

Location: Epsom, Surrey

Pay: 12.34 per hour

Hours: 8am to 2pm (30 hours Monday-Friday)

Duration: Temp to Perm

We are looking for an Assistant Chef who is multi-skilled across the kitchen to support the delivery of meals for the Council's community services. The main duties are:

  • Ordering food, stock control, preparation, cooking, serving, and clearing after service.
  • Deputise for the Head Chef in their absence by creating diverse menu options.
  • Ensure health and safety requirements in the kitchen are met.
  • Adhere to all food hygiene guidelines.
  • Competently and securely operate industrial-standard ovens, cooktops, Bain Maries, dishwashers, walk-in freezers and other kitchen equipment.
  • Monitor and record all food hygiene information and procedures.
  • Track stock levels and supplies to minimise waste.
  • Accurately and confidently inform service users about any relevant issues regarding allergies and the contents of all food produced.
  • Work under instruction, both individually and as part of a team, to contribute to the cleanliness of the site.
  • Participate in training provided to successfully perform the role and meet expected standards.
  • Meet designated targets within specified time frames as outlined in the agreed work schedule for each day or week.
  • Proactively respond to and resolve any issues that arise in addition to the agreed work schedule.
  • Wear the appropriate uniform and protective clothing provided, and conduct yourself in a manner that promotes the professionalism of the Council.
  • Operate in a way that protects your health and safety, as well as that of others, in accordance with the Health and Safety at Work Act 1974.
  • Take responsibility for raising any issues, concerns, or suggestions to help the Manager meet targets and ensure the Council complies with its statutory requirements.
